Как извлечь указанное значение c из тела запроса в POSTMAN и сохранить в переменной - PullRequest
2 голосов
/ 28 апреля 2020

Есть ли способ получить указанное c значение (businessType) из тела запроса и сохранить в переменной в почтальоне?

Тело запроса

{
    "fein": "nurrk",
    "businessType": "LLP",
    "incorporationYear": 1993,
    "incorporationState": "stateelesss",
    "annualRevenue": 1000,
    "companyActivity": "Producctiionn",
    "stockSymbol": "starer",
    "mcc": "qa12345"
}

POSTMAN SS

Я использовал разные команды, и, похоже, ни одна из них не работает

var reqBody = JSON.parse(request.data);

1 Ответ

1 голос
/ 28 апреля 2020

Вы можете использовать pm.request для получения данных из тела запроса:

let businessType = JSON.parse(pm.request.body.raw).businessType;

pm.environment.set('businessType', businessType);

Более подробную информацию об API pm.* можно найти здесь:

https://learning.postman.com/docs/postman/scripts/postman-sandbox-api-reference/

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...